Boosters are dropped when somebody crafts a badge for that game and randomly distributed among those who are eligible for it, not completely randomly. And the more cards the badge needs, the more boosters are created.

How can I get a booster pack?

Once you have received all of your card drops, you become eligible for a booster pack, which is a set of 3 trading cards that may include both basic and foil cards. Booster packs are granted randomly to eligible users as more badges are crafted by members of the community. Make sure you log in to Steam each week to maintain eligibility.

Once eligible, your Steam Level increases your rate of receiving a booster pack drop:

Level 10: +20% increase in your drop rate
Level 20: +40% increase in your drop rate
Level 30: +60% increase in your drop rate
Level 40: +80% increase in your drop rate
Level 50: +100% increase in your drop rate (i.e. the rate has doubled)
Etc. 

http://steamcommunity.com/tradingcards/faq/

Because it is a little ambiguous. Think like this:

All booster packs are handed out through a raffle. All players eligible for a booster present themselves in a number of tickets in the raffle. A level 1 player enters with 5 tickets. A level 10 with 5+5×0.2=6 tickets. A level 100 with 5+5×1.00=10 tickets. So at level 100 you have twice as better chance to win the booster pack, as a level 1 player. The levels only tip the scale a little bit so low-level users can win too.
